Adaptive Visual Rendering
Another major highlight is its adaptive rendering engine, which adjusts lighting, contrast, and object details based on where a player’s eyes are focused. This ensures that the most important parts of the screen remain crisp and realistic, while less critical areas are slightly blurred — just like real human vision. The result is a more cinematic and immersive gaming experience.
